In their decision today, the Supreme Court did not include the financial crimes issue as a reason for a new trial because they said essentially Becky Hill's behavior was enough.
And the interesting fact as we move forward toward a possible retrial is that the financial crimes were key for the prosecution's case as the motive for the murders.
It was a crucial piece.
And I mean, everybody wants to know why.
And the financial crimes seem to explain that and lay out the why.
